Flood Quilts

The recent flooding here in Colorado left many without homes and many others with major clean up and loss. Our home was not affected, but our hearts go out to the many that were. There are many photos online, but I have included one here, just to emphasize what so many have experienced.




When I walked into Sweetheart Quilt Shop a couple of weeks ago to pick up something I was in need of, I walked out with my arms full of quilt tops that needed to be quilted. These tops were made by generous quilters who have worked to provide something special for the many victims of this flood.

Below are a couple photos of some of these quilts. The goal at Sweetheart is to obtain 500 quilts to be donated to those affected. If you have not already done so, I would encourage you to stop in to their shop to see how you can help out.
